Frequently Asked Questions

  • How is the weather in Lagos de Moreno?

    Lagos de Moreno usually has a temperate climate, with temperatures ranging from 50°F (10°C) during cooler months to about 86°F (30°C) in the warmer season. Rainfall is common from June through September, while the rest of the year is relatively dry.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Lagos de Moreno?

    Visitors can explore the city's rich history by visiting colonial landmarks like the Parroquia de Nuestra Señora de la Asunción and the Teatro José Rosas Moreno. For nature enthusiasts, a trip to the Presa La Sauceda offers peaceful outdoor settings.

  • What is the best time of year to visit Lagos de Moreno?

    The most popular time to visit Lagos de Moreno is from November to March when the weather is dry and pleasant. During this period, visitors can enjoy the annual Festival Del Señor De La Misericordia, a local fair with cultural performances and traditional food.

  • What are the best places to stay in Lagos de Moreno?

    The city center is a popular place for accommodation as it is close to many historical landmarks and local restaurants. For those seeking tranquillity, the outskirts of Lagos de Moreno provide serene settings close to nature.

  • What are the best places to visit in Lagos de Moreno?

    In addition to the beautiful colonial architecture of Parroquia de Nuestra Señora de la Asunción, visitors often explore the Museo Municipal Lagos de Moreno. The Panteón Antiguo is another frequently suggested spot, known for its historical significance.

  • What are some hiking trails in Lagos de Moreno?

    While Lagos de Moreno isn't particularly known for hiking, the surrounding areas have a few trails. For example, the Sierra de Lobos Park, about 30 miles (48 km) from town, is known by locals for its beautiful trails and natural scenery.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as in Lagos de Moreno?

    Visitors often take day trips to nearby cities such as León, known for its leather goods markets, and Guanajuato, a UNESCO World Heritage site. The beautiful town of San Juan de los Lagos is also a popular choice for a day trip.
